Finally got some decent weather without rain. Took the car out there just to see if it would go straight. Well......it did not go straight! It will take some suspension tweaking to make this thing go straight and 60ft like it is supposed to. Also my transmission had problems again as it did not have 2nd gear. I ran this pass with 1st gear and third gear only as you will see in the in-car vid when I post it up later. No excuses....still have a lot of work to do and I am please with the first shakedown pass.
9.56 @ 143.68 mph with a 1.42 60ft. 3450lbs raceweight (weighed it last night.)
This was only with a 250 shot. I have to fix the other issues before I hit it with more.
